Harleston's Future Harleston's Future was set up by local residents and businesses to ensure the continued prosperity and well-being of Harleston on the Norfolk/Suffolk border.

Events and community initiatives add vitality to the town and attract more visitors. Harleston's Future was established by Harleston & District Business Forum in 2013 to help the town respond to change and draw in visitors to support the local shops and businesses. We believe that Harleston, with its plethora of historic buildings and architecture, delightful range of independent shops, cafe's, pu

bs and hotels and its position in the heart of the beautiful Waveney Valley, makes a fabulous addition to any holiday itinerary or day out from City or Coast.

William Shakespeare, a young Latin tutor, falls in love with the free-spirited Agnes and marries her despite his parentsโ€™ disapproval. In due course they have three children, but William heads to London to pursue his career as a dramatist, leaving his family in Stratford. During his absence young Hamnet falls sick with the plague, and dies before his father arrives home. Later Agnes journeys to London to watch her husbandโ€™s latest play, Hamlet.
